(Andrey Borodulin/AFP/Getty Images/FILE) Mariupol, a port city on the Sea of Azov, is located in Ukraine’s Donetsk Oblast and has been under direct Russian control since May 2022. Russian attacks on Mariupol began on February 24, 2022 – the first day of the invasion. The city was subjected to some of the war’s worst atrocities. Spread the love According to the Commission of Inquiry on Ukraineset up one year ago at the request of the Human Rights CouncilRussian troops committed a “wide range” of violations across the country, many of which are war crimes. These included attacks with explosive weapons in populated areas, wilful killings of civilians, unlawful confinement, torture, rape and other sexual violenceas well as unlawful transfers and deportations of children.
